In this case, staff will need to estimate the pumping rate when doing the <br /> delineation calculations for the DWSAP assessment. <br /> Screened Interval <br /> Screened interval is also used in the delineation calculations and in the PBE evaluation. <br /> The screened interval is that portion of the well casing that has screens or perforations <br /> through which water enters the well. The screen allows ground water to move freely <br /> from the aquifer into the well while stabilizing the aquifer material. The length of <br /> screened interval is used in the delineation calculations to represent the portion of the <br /> aquifer that the well can draw from. In general,the greater the screened interval,the <br /> more aquifer that the well can pull from,and the less horizontal distance away that a <br /> particular volume of water will travel within a given time period. Typically, several <br /> portions of the well casing are screened. <br /> The WDS asks for three pieces of information about the screened interval,which can <br /> generally be found in the well drillers' Iog.Each of the fields for screened interval is <br /> described below: <br /> Depth to the Highest Perforations/Screens—The depth to the first perforations should <br /> be entered in feet below ground surface. If the information is not available enter <br /> "Unknown". <br /> Screened Interval Beginning Depth/Ending Depth—The beginning depth of the first <br /> screened interval should be entered in feet below ground surface, followed by a slash(n <br /> then the ending depth of the interval should be entered. If there are more screened <br /> intervals they should be entered the same way separated by a semicolon from the <br /> previous one. The field length can accommodate several screened intervals. <br /> Total Length of Screened Interval—The length of all the screened intervals should be <br /> added and the value placed in this field. This value is used in the delineation and PBE <br /> calculations. Sometimes, information may be available on the length of screens, but not <br /> the specific beginning and ending depths. The total length should be entered here and the <br /> previous field should be left blank_ At other times,you may know the beginning and <br /> ending depths of all screens,but have no knowledge whether the entire interval is <br /> screened. In this case,the total length of screened interval can be determined as the <br /> distance between the beginning and ending of the perforations, but this may result in <br /> smaller protection zones. Judgment should be used to determine the appropriate length. <br /> The DWSAP program allows a default screened interval of 10% of the pumping capacity <br /> of the well in gallons per minute,with a minimum length of 10 feet. For example, the <br /> default screened interval for a well that has a pumping capacity of 400 gpm would be 40 <br /> feet. This is a conservative value for most wells. If the default method is used to <br /> determine screened interval this should be noted in the"Actual,Estimated or Default?" <br /> column. <br />
